Wi-Fi Calling is allows you to make voice calls, send text messages, and sometimes even video calls over a Wi-Fi network instead of using a cellular network. Most modern smartphones support Wi-Fi Calling, but it’s essential to check if your device and offers this feature. You can typically enable Wi-Fi Calling through your device’s settings.
